Abstract:People with heart failure need support and family presence to improve their quality of life. Nurses' views about family-centered care may be changed if they were taught about the idea and encouraged to support its implementation. In addition, families might provide help to ill relatives. This study aims to investigate the influence of education on nurses' attitudes about family-centered care for intensive care patients with heart failure.
